§ 18-210. Disinfection, destruction of houses exposed to disease
In general
(a) To prevent the spread of an infectious or contagious disease that endangers public health, a health officer may have:
(1) Any part of a house disinfected if the house has been exposed to the disease; and
(2) Any article in the house disinfected or destroyed if the article has been exposed to the disease.
Cost, reimbursement by county
(b) The county where the house is located shall:
(1) Incur the expense of disinfecting the house; and
(2) Reasonably compensate a person who suffers damage from the exercise of a power granted by this section, if the person is not at fault.

Credits

Added by Acts 1982, c. 21, § 2, eff. July 1, 1982.
Formerly Art. 43, § 55.
